The AAD is seeking member comments on draft clinical practice guidelines on the management of atopic dermatitis (AD) with topical therapies in adults. These guidelines appraise evidence of the efficacy and safety of topical treatments for AD. The development of these guidelines followed a systematic approach and recommendations were formed by a guideline work group that includes experts in AD management from multiple clinical settings, a methodologist, and a patient representative. The comment period is open to all AAD members and comments are being accepted through May 30, 2022. Feedback received will be provided to the guideline development work group for review.
